Cette page a été traduite à partir de l'anglais par la communauté. Vous pouvez contribuer en rejoignant la communauté francophone sur MDN Web Docs.

View in English Always switch to English

Chemin d'une URI

Le chemin d'une URI est la section qui vient après l'autorité. Il contient des données, généralement organisées de façon hiérarchique, pour identifier une ressource dans le cadre du schéma et de l'autorité de nommage de l'URI.

Syntaxe

url
http://example.com:80<path>
urn:<path>

Le chemin peut contenir presque tous les caractères, sauf ? et # (qui débutent respectivement la requête et le fragment), ainsi que d'autres caractères réservés par le schéma URI. Certains schémas (appelés schémas hiérarchiques) analysent le chemin comme une séquence de segments séparés par des barres obliques (/) ; d'autres le considèrent comme une chaîne opaque unique.

Description

Le chemin suit l'autorité et se termine au premier point d'interrogation (?), dièse (#) ou à la fin de l'URI. Dans les deux URIs suivantes :

url
urn:nbn:de:bvb:19-epub-5359-3
https://example.com:80/images/animated/ayse.gif

nbn:de:bvb:19-epub-5359-3 est le chemin de l'URN. /images/animated/ayse.gif est le chemin de l'URI https.

Chaque URI possède un composant chemin, ce qui signifie que les chemins dans les exemples suivants sont une barre oblique (/) dans la première URL et un composant chemin vide dans la seconde :

url
https://example.com/
https://example.com

Les navigateurs, y compris l'API web URL, normalisent les chemins vides en /.

Spécifications

Specification
Unknown specification
# section-3.3

Voir aussi